Historical & Cultural Background
Kenshi is a name of Japanese origin, often associated with martial arts, particularly kendo, which translates to 'the way of the sword.' In Japanese culture, names often carry significant meanings and are chosen based on the desired traits for the child. The name Kenshi can also be linked to various historical figures in Japan, particularly samurai.
